Septic Installation Service in Denver, CO

Septic installation services involve setting up a septic system that safely manages wastewater for properties not connected to municipal sewer lines. This process typically includes site evaluation, system design, and the installation of components such as septic tanks and drain fields. Homeowners often seek these services when building new homes, replacing outdated systems, or upgrading existing setups to meet current requirements. Understanding the size and capacity needed for a household, as well as local regulations and soil conditions, can help property owners plan effectively before requesting installation.

Property owners should consider factors such as the size of their household, property layout, and future expansion plans when exploring septic installation options. It’s also important to understand the different types of systems available and their maintenance needs. Proper planning ensures the system functions efficiently and complies with local health and environmental standards. Contacting a professional for guidance can help clarify project scope, site suitability, and any necessary permits before proceeding with the installation.

Project Types

Common Septic Installation Service Jobs

Septic System Design - creating customized plans tailored to property size and usage needs.

Septic Tank Installation - installing new tanks that meet local codes and ensure proper function.

Drain Field Setup - establishing effective drain fields to facilitate waste absorption and prevent backups.

System Replacement - upgrading aging or failing septic systems to improve reliability and performance.

Septic System Inspection - evaluating existing systems to identify issues before problems develop.

Septic System Repair - addressing leaks, clogs, or other malfunctions to restore proper operation.

FAQ

Septic Installation Service Questions

What is involved in septic installation? Septic installation includes designing, site preparation, and setting up the septic tank and drain field to ensure proper waste management for the property.

How do I know if my property needs a new septic system? Signs include persistent odors, slow drains, or pooling water near the drain field, indicating the current system may need replacement or upgrade.

What types of septic systems are available? Options include conventional gravity systems, mound systems, and pressure distribution systems, selected based on site conditions and property needs.

What should property owners consider before installing a septic system? Factors include soil type, property size, local regulations, and future maintenance requirements to ensure proper system function.
